Comparing Begur’s Best Villas & Coves

Begur’s coves shape the feel of your stay more than guests expect. Sa Riera is practical and direct, with easier access, simpler beach days, and straightforward returns home, though it can feel busier at peak times.

Aiguablava delivers that iconic turquoise Costa Brava look, bright, scenic, and swim-focused, but popularity means timing and villa privacy matter.

Sa Tuna leans intimate and traditional, postcard charm with a quieter rhythm, less about errands and more about settling into the cove itself.

If you are choosing between two bases, prioritize the one that minimizes transitions and decisions, shorter walks from bedroom to pool, easier parking, and fewer timing compromises.

Cultural & Coastal Highlights in Begur

Begur rewards unhurried exploring, especially earlier in the day when the streets are quieter and the light is softer.

  • Old town wander + castle walk: Stroll Begur’s medieval streets, then hike up to the castle for wide, 360-degree views.
  • The Golden Triangle (easy day trip): Spend a late morning exploring the nearby medieval villages of Pals and Peratallada. Keep it simple.
  • Camí de Ronda at your own tempo: Choose a short section of the coastal path instead of committing to an all-day hike.
  • Swim-first coves: For the clear, turquoise-water experience, plan a swim at Aiguablava. For deeper water and a more tucked-away feel, head to Platja Sa Fonda.

 

To keep evenings low-effort, choose one destination dinner and make it a ritual rather than a nightly plan.

Timing is Everything

When to Book Your Begur Villa Rentals

If your goal is a quiet, restorative stay in Begur, timing matters. The same coastline can feel deeply tranquil or noticeably hectic depending on the month.

For most of our guests, prioritizing comfort, sleep, and a calmer pace, many choose May and June for warm, bright days without peak summer intensity, making beaches, restaurants, and roads easier to enjoy without over planning.

September and October are often ideal for longer, wellness-style stays, when the atmosphere feels more local again and the coastal light softens beautifully.

July and August bring energy and social buzz, which can be fun, but they are not the easiest months for extreme quiet or spontaneous, low-effort days.

A practical mindset helps: choose your dates first, then refine location, favor morning outings in warmer periods, and stay longer if possible.

Travel & Logistics

Arriving in Costa Brava

Begur is easiest when you treat it like a small coastal base, not a place you can fully do on foot. The old town is walkable once you are there, but most villas, coves, and viewpoint drives require wheels.

You will typically arrive via one of two airports:

  • Girona-Costa Brava Airport: Closer on the map and often the most direct route into the Costa Brava.
  • Barcelona-El Prat Airport: A larger international hub with more flight options, then a longer drive north to Begur.

Transportation choices, candidly:

  • Rental car (strongly recommended): The best option if you want freedom to explore hidden coves.
  • Private transfer (comfort-first): A good fit if you prefer not to drive after flying or you want a smoother start to the stay.
  • Driver on call (maximum ease): Ideal if you want beach days and dinners without thinking about parking or late-night driving.

A few practical notes once you are in Begur:

  • Parking and access: Some locations are easier than others for drop-offs and daily in-and-out driving.
  • Plan coves like micro-excursions: Even short distances can take longer in peak periods.
  • Keep arrival day light: Build in time to settle, stock the kitchen, and enjoy the villa.

In Begur, confirm parking and access details in advance, treat cove visits as small excursions with extra time built in, and keep arrival day intentionally light so you can settle in and ease into the rhythm.
